Responsibilities
- Perform comprehensive diagnostics and repairs on HVAC systems, including air conditioning units, boilers, refrigeration equipment, and building automation systems.
- Install new HVAC systems and components following schematics and HVAC design specifications.
- Troubleshoot electrical systems using diagnostic tools such as ohmmeters and conduct electrical diagnostics to identify faults.
- Maintain and service plumbing connections related to HVAC equipment to ensure proper operation.
- Conduct routine preventive maintenance on mechanical systems to maximize efficiency and lifespan.
- Read and interpret schematics, technical manuals, and building automation system diagrams for accurate repairs and installations.
- Provide exceptional customer service by explaining repairs clearly and ensuring client satisfaction throughout every interaction.
Requirements
- Proven experience in construction or property maintenance with a focus on HVAC system repair and installation.
- Service technician experience with a strong understanding of HVAC/R (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ning / Refrigeration) systems.
- Knowledge of HVAC design principles, schematics, electrical diagnostics, refrigeration processes, and mechanical systems repair.
- Ability to operate hand tools effectively for equipment troubleshooting and mechanical repairs.
- Experience working with building automation systems (BAS) and electrical systems within commercial or industrial settings.
-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record; possession of a <PERSON> driver license preferred.
- Certifications such as EPA (Environmental Protection Agency) refrigerant handling certification are required; additional certifications in ammonia refrigeration or boiler operation are a plus.
- Strong mechanical knowledge combined with excellent customer service skills to ensure quality work and client satisfaction.
